Starting out, if you want lane domination you want pure sustain. There's little to no need for Mage's Blessing nor any early purchase for sdtacks as you'll have the sustain and restoration to stay in lane and farm up, plus these second-level shoes have great stats in comparison to other items early on.

By now you should have completed your shoes and I strongly recommend the "purple" shoes as it gives extra power and pen that is really useful for Zeus himself. As well, the next two items is just where you stand financially, meaning that you should go for Book of Thoth first, it's just a matter of gold of which level you can buy. I prefer Book of Thoth over Warlock's early on as these stacks are easier to complete, hence giving you it's passive quicker to help dominate and why not grab some more pots with that extra bit of change? :)

At this point in the game, your stacks should be complete from Book of Thoth and should be around halfway complete on Warlock's. You can decide on whether to build pen or lifesteal next, but at least the "purple" shoes give you some pen to chip away at any protection. Wards are always great and they should be bought all the time, but they're much more important here as the enemy team is more likely to rotate and well... you're Zeus...

With Spear of the Magnus, landing your abilities reduce your targets protection by 12 (max 3 stack) which is very useful with Zeus' ability combo
Spear of Desolation takes a second off of all of your cool downs when you receive a kill or assist, this is great in team fights where your burst damage is much needed

Witch blade offers some Hp and also a bit of attack speed!(good for shooting shield) However, it lowers your enemy's attack speed which may be the key decider if a sneaky god like loki or someone quick like Awilix gets up on you.
Mantle offers great protection for both types but it's passive stuns enemies and gives you purification if your health gets too low, this can give a perfect opportunity to flee from any gank or assassin, or of course melt them with your combo

Hey guys! I love Zeus ( mastery 10 ) and I build all sorts of things on him, here's some combinations that I have had success within the past!
I've listed a few threats above ( and will list more) but for the main part, anybody who can deal high damage, mobile and have a nice leap/dash can be a threat to Zeus as he is rather slow, has now getaway and is relatively squishy!
